SummaryofGriffithexperiment
Smoothbacteriaescapetheimmunesystemandkillmice.
Roughbacteriaaredestroyedbytheimmunesystem.
Treatingsmoothbacteriawithheatkillsthemandtheyarenolongerinfectious.
Addingheatkilledsmoothbacteriatoroughbacteriatransformssomeofthemintosmoothbacteria.
Thesubstanceiscalledthetransformingprinciple.
HowdidAvery,MacLeodandMcCartyshowtherewerenoproteinsintheirpurifiedDNA?
Theytreatedthesampleswithproteasesandshowedthatthisdidnotaffecttransformation.Proteaseswoulddegradetheproteins.
HowdidtheyshowtherewasnoRNAintheirpurifiedDNA?
TheytreatedthesampleswithRNases(ribonucleases).RNaseswoulddegradeanycontaminatingRNA.Againthisdidnotstoptransformation.
ThentheytreatedtheirsampleswithDNases.DNaseswoulddegradetheDNAintheirsamples.TreatmentofsamplesofthetransformingprinciplewithDNaseseliminateditsabilitytotransformbacteria.
SummaryofHershey-Chaseexperiment
WhatdidHersheyandChaseusetolabeltheDNA?
BacteriophageT2DNAwaslabeledwith32P.
WhatdidHersheyandChaseusetolabeltheprotein?
T2proteinwaslabeledwith35S.
E.coliwereinfectedwiththeT2samples.
HowdidtheystoptheinfectionandremovetheT2fromthesurfaceofthebacteria?
byspinningthesamplesinablender
HowdidtheyseparatetheT2bacteriophagefromtheE.colibacteria?
Thesampleswerecentrifuged.TheT2wasinthesupernatantandtheE.coliwasinthepellet.
The35SproteindidnotentertheE.coli,butthe32PDNAdidentertheE.coli.
HersheyandChaseconcluded:
DNAisthetransformingprincipleandthehereditaryorgeneticmaterial.
